Expert level development experience in C/C++ (C++ preferable), deep understanding of device drivers and bare metal for peripherals like DMA, I2C, UART, deep knowledge of bus architectures including AXI and NOC, experience with RTOS like Zephyr or FreeRTOS, firmware/hardware debugging expertise, good communication skills, and being a team player are required.
The primary location is Bengaluru, Karnataka, India, with Shift 1 (India).
A B.E/B.Tech/M.Tech. in Computer Science or Electronics Engineering is required.
This is a full-time regular job.
Experience in firmware development on FPGAs, QP Framework development, or transceivers protocols like PCIe/Ethernet will be a big advantage.
